Investigation for Anti Diabetic properties of Methanol Extracts prepared from Dried Apricot Kernels in Rats

To support this anti diabetic activity of apricot kernels is performed. In this study alloxan induced diabetic activity model rat was used. First the kernels are authenticated then extracted using methanol. The methanol extracts showed the presence of alkaloids, tannins, flavonoids etc. which maybe the reason for anti-diabetic activity. Alloxan forms an increased glucose levels that generates diabetes. Post treatment with apricot kernel extract produced significant decrease in glucose levels indicating the therapeutic effect of extract. The method for testing glucose levels in blood is done by glucometer On treatment a dose dependent (low dose-100mg/kg, high dose-200mg/kg.) decrease in glucose levels were observed. For the low dose, the glucose level decreased to 150.1±17mg/dl by 7th day from 293.1±9.83mg/dl. For the high dose, the glucose level decreased to 125.7±20.7mg/dl by 7th day from 280.5±42.4mg/dl. However, the standard medicine metformin at the dose of 450mg/kg showed better results with 112.3±2.4mg/dl. Even though the extracts results are lower than the standard with further research and purification of extracts better results can be achieved.
